As previously outlined, there is a expanding body of research that suggests numerous adverse experiences and outcomes are associated with youth sport settings 44 , 46 Potential adverse experiences and outcomes of sport participation in older adults need to also be examined. For example, there is mounting proof that the dose-response relationship involving physical activity and wellness outcomes is not linear. Excessive aerobic coaching is associated with increased danger of overuse injuries 72 and immune technique dysfunction 73 In addition, ‘exercise abuse’ 74 , 75 is a increasing area of concern amongst researchers and health-related practitioners. The dose-response partnership between physical activity involvement and overall health advantages may differ based on the health outcome under consideration.

With ageing, shortness of breath gets larger, gaining weight is popular and physical balance gets weaker. The elderly’s capacity to stay independant is decreased, falls dangers are higher. Staying inactive could be risky for the elderly. In order to fight these consequences, the soft workout can be a terrific therapy.

Lawn Bowling – A great group sport that provides the advantages of socialization and a gentle fitness activity for older adults. There are clubs just for the 50+ and senior generations. Tai-Chi allows the elderly with well being problems such arthritis or heart troubles to maintain a effective physical activity. This sport can strengthen the muscle tone, strengthen balance and flexibility, thanks to fluid and slow movements.
